Hey, I'm doing an EB run now! ^^ This track definitely brings back some awesome memories, and I think your arrangement has done a fantastic job in preserving its most defining feature - sinplicity. You've stayed almost entirely faithful to the original, keeping the number of parts low, so much so that it reads a little like a transcription...and I'll talk more about that later, but for now you've got a clean and simple score which does what it needs to do :)

I think the main issue I see is that the quaver note ostinato above the melody line might sound a little off. I think it is kinda.okay if you can shape it, but not very natural. Yet, it's such a characteristic feature of your score that I think it'd be unfair to suggest changing that, so yeah. It's a tiny bit awkward, but more or less can be made to work.

You've also made pretty much an exact transcription of the melody and bass line, along with the ostinato. That's really good, but when those parts are played together, it can sound thin. The guitar part in the original covers a larger frequency range and is more resonant than a piano can ever be, so it fills harmonies much better. Some parts have really awkward three-/two-part harmony. Um, pardon the theory haha, but here's a list:

- b. 11 bt 4: kinda-exposed octave. contrary motion yeah, but it sounds really empty there.
- b. 13-16: generally lack 3rd of chords, which sounds ambiguous after a while
- b. 21: consecutive 5ths.
- b. 26 bt 3: F# and G clash, aaand balancing it is exceptionally hard here
- end repeat bar: no bass harmony notes on strong beats, making the chord progression ambiguous.

Funny; you just listed a number of my concerns about this piece as well.

One of the more frustrating aspects about Earthbound's music is that a lot of the instruments tend to be in the same range as one another. It's impossible to put in every voice of the song, since it would clash way too often. This leaves three options: keep it the way it is (and have lots of clashing), lower/raise it one or more octaves (which might make it sound weird), or taking it out altogether (which leaves it sounding empty). Earthbound's soundtrack has a lot of layering & sustained notes, so that last one isn't really an option.

In this particular case, the guitar clashes with the main melody. As you can see, I tried keeping as many notes as I could without clashing, but this leads to a much emptier-sounding R.H. I would've put the guitar in the left hand, but I decided against it initially for two major reasons: 1) it just would've sounded weirder, and 2) the bass moves up and down so often that it would be difficult to keep any consistency in the guitar part. 

Of course, upon taking a closer inspection, I think it might be worth trying to put the guitar in the L.H. I did something similar for a more recent arrangement, and it turned out okay. I'll let you know if it works out.

Actually, I think I've found something. To quote Wikipedia regarding the Mother 2 official soundtrack:

Quote from: WikipediaThe soundtrack album for EarthBound was released by Sony Records in Japan on November 2, 1994. It was re-released a decade later on February 18, 2004 by Sony Music Direct. The album has 24 tracks, where many of these tracks are arrangements combining several pieces from the game into one piece.
The tracklist given by Wikipedia then goes on to list Twoson's theme as:
Quote from: Wikipedia3. "Theme of Twoson" (from "Boy Meets Girl")
This website also seems to corroborate this claim as well (https://web.archive.org/web/20131002155842/http://rpgfan.com/soundtracks/mother2/index.html).

Maybe it doesn't completely convince you, but it is at the very least an instance of "Boy Meets Girl" in something officially sanctioned.

More:
-Measure 37 LH beat two D should be a C.
-In general (not really an "error," just something that should make it easier for you in the future) the preset defaults for how the first two layers (black and red) function are worked so that the first layer defaults as the "upper" layer and the second layer as the lower, in terms of alignment things. For example, articulations are normally set to appear in the opposite side of the staff as the other layer, meaning that when both layers are in use, the red will automatically set them below the staff while the black layer will automatically set them above the staff. Alignment of seconds between layers is also always in favor of layer one. So as the finale user, you can save time working with the program when you think "upper and lower splits" rather than each layer being an individual entity.
